    fuel tank

    Been looking at a 93 2door for parts,has no wheels so is sitting on ground.It has what looks like a sub tank in r rear quarter panel and the main tank looks to be steel,maybe fabricated?But sitting on ground i cant really see it.My question is does this model have a steel or plastic tank?Im hoping it is a full long range tank which would make purchase price very good.

    If it is an aftermarket tank, could be like the one I have, Long Ranger. The main tank is 120 ltrs and looks fairly flat from underneath and is a tight fit between the chassis rails, the side tank is an extra 35 ltrs. Long Ranger have a kit that connects them, look for crossover pipes on the right hand side near the chassis, might have a metal cover over them. The side tank cannot be connected to a standard tank because of the plumbing, so looks good for your purchase. If you end up using all the plumbing, don't cut any of it, keep them for length and fit examples. Good Luck.

    Its possible that it has a 35ltr pocket tank in conjunction with twin under slung lpg tanks , its uncommon to have both a long range tank and auxiliary tank .

    If it's a steel long range tank, be sure to thoroughly inspect it's insides. I had an experience with a long range tank in my disco, some rust had formed around a porous weld. The result was a replacement of the fuel pump, pickup, sedimenter, lines and injector pump.
